Searched refs:IdxTy (Results 1 - 9 of 9) sorted by relevance
/freebsd-9.3-release/contrib/llvm/lib/Transforms/Scalar/ |
H A D | ScalarReplAggregates.cpp | 162 Type *&IdxTy); 1993 Type *IdxTy; local 1994 uint64_t Idx = FindElementAndOffset(T, EltOffset, IdxTy); 2007 /// element. IdxTy is set to the type of the index result to be used in a 2010 Type *&IdxTy) { 2017 IdxTy = Type::getInt32Ty(T->getContext()); 2024 IdxTy = Type::getInt64Ty(T->getContext()); 2032 IdxTy = Type::getInt64Ty(T->getContext()); 2055 Type *IdxTy; local 2056 uint64_t OldIdx = FindElementAndOffset(T, OldOffset, IdxTy); 2009 FindElementAndOffset(Type *&T, uint64_t &Offset, Type *&IdxTy) argument 2108 Type *IdxTy; local [all...] |
/freebsd-9.3-release/contrib/llvm/lib/Transforms/InstCombine/ |
H A D | InstCombineLoadStoreAlloca.cpp | 183 Type *IdxTy = TD local 186 Value *NullIdx = Constant::getNullValue(IdxTy); 306 Type *IdxTy = TD local 309 Value *Idx = Constant::getNullValue(IdxTy);
|
/freebsd-9.3-release/contrib/llvm/lib/CodeGen/AsmPrinter/ |
H A D | DwarfCompileUnit.cpp | 1705 DIE *IdxTy = getIndexTyDie(); local 1706 if (!IdxTy) { 1708 IdxTy = createAndAddDIE(dwarf::DW_TAG_base_type, *CUDie.get()); 1709 addString(IdxTy, dwarf::DW_AT_name, "int"); 1710 addUInt(IdxTy, dwarf::DW_AT_byte_size, None, sizeof(int32_t)); 1711 addUInt(IdxTy, dwarf::DW_AT_encoding, dwarf::DW_FORM_data1, 1713 setIndexTyDie(IdxTy); 1721 constructSubrangeDIE(Buffer, DISubrange(Element), IdxTy);
|
/freebsd-9.3-release/contrib/llvm/lib/Transforms/Vectorize/ |
H A D | LoopVectorize.cpp | 1534 Type *IdxTy = Legal->getWidestInductionType(); local 1546 IdxTy->getPrimitiveSizeInBits()) 1547 ExitCount = SE->getTruncateOrNoop(ExitCount, IdxTy); 1549 ExitCount = SE->getNoopOrZeroExtend(ExitCount, IdxTy); 1568 IdxTy): 1569 ConstantInt::get(IdxTy, 0); 1606 Induction = Builder.CreatePHI(IdxTy, 2, "index"); 1609 Constant *Step = ConstantInt::get(IdxTy, VF * UF); 1619 if (Count->getType() != IdxTy) { 1623 Count = BypassBuilder.CreatePointerCast(Count, IdxTy, "ptrcn [all...] |
/freebsd-9.3-release/contrib/llvm/lib/Transforms/IPO/ |
H A D | ArgumentPromotion.cpp | 689 Type *IdxTy = (ElTy->isStructTy() ? local 692 Ops.push_back(ConstantInt::get(IdxTy, *II));
|
H A D | GlobalOpt.cpp | 2444 IntegerType *IdxTy = IntegerType::get(NewTy->getContext(), 32); local 2445 Constant *IdxZero = ConstantInt::get(IdxTy, 0, false);
|
/freebsd-9.3-release/contrib/llvm/lib/IR/ |
H A D | ConstantFold.cpp | 2012 Type *IdxTy = Combined->getType(); local 2013 if (IdxTy != Idx0->getType()) { 2014 Type *Int64Ty = Type::getInt64Ty(IdxTy->getContext());
|
/freebsd-9.3-release/contrib/llvm/tools/clang/lib/CodeGen/ |
H A D | CGExpr.cpp | 2249 QualType IdxTy = E->getIdx()->getType(); local 2250 bool IdxSigned = IdxTy->isSignedIntegerOrEnumerationType(); 2253 EmitBoundsCheck(E, E->getBase(), Idx, IdxTy, Accessed);
|
H A D | CGExprScalar.cpp | 1074 QualType IdxTy = E->getIdx()->getType(); local 1077 CGF.EmitBoundsCheck(E, E->getBase(), Idx, IdxTy, /*Accessed*/true); 1079 bool IdxSigned = IdxTy->isSignedIntegerOrEnumerationType();
|
Completed in 236 milliseconds